  • Lightweight
    MicroPython is designed to be a streamlined version of Python, optimized for microcontrollers and small embedded systems. It has a smaller footprint than full Python, making it ideal for constrained environments.
  • Python Compatibility
    MicroPython is largely compatible with standard Python (Python 3.x), which allows developers who are familiar with Python to easily adapt to MicroPython for embedded applications.
  • Real-Time Capabilities
    MicroPython supports real-time operating systems and can handle tasks that require precise timing, making it suitable for controlling hardware directly.
  • Active Community
    MicroPython has a growing community of developers and enthusiasts who contribute to its development, provide support, and share resources and libraries.
  • Cross-Platform Support
    MicroPython can run on a wide range of hardware platforms, including popular boards like ESP8266, ESP32, and Raspberry Pi Pico, offering flexibility for developers.

Possible disadvantages

  • Limited Library Support
    Not all Python libraries are available in MicroPython, and some may require re-implementation or adaptation to work within the constraints of microcontrollers.
  • Performance Constraints
    Due to its lightweight nature and the limited resources of typical target devices, MicroPython may not perform as well as standard Python in terms of speed and processing power.
  • Learning Curve for Hardware Interfacing
    Developers who are new to embedded systems may face a learning curve when it comes to hardware interfacing and understanding the limitations and capabilities of microcontrollers.
  • Memory Limitations
    Microcontrollers have significantly less memory than computers, which can limit the complexity of programs that can be run using MicroPython.
  • Fragmented Development Environment
    Compared to standard Python, the tools and IDE support for MicroPython can be less mature and more fragmented, which may make development more challenging.
  • Bidirectional Linking
    Logseq allows users to easily create bidirectional links between notes, enhancing organization and navigation through related information.
  • Graph View
    The graph view provides a visual representation of how notes are interconnected, helping users see the bigger picture of their knowledge network.
  • Markdown Support
    Logseq supports Markdown, making it easy to format notes and write in a widely-used plain text format.
  • Local Storage
    Notes are stored locally, giving users full control over their data and enhancing privacy and security.
  • Customizable Workflows
    Users can customize their workflows with plugins and templates to suit their specific needs and preferences.
  • Open Source
    Being an open-source project, Logseq invites community contributions and ensures more transparency in development and issue resolution.
  • Task Management
    Logseq integrates task management features, such as to-do lists and scheduling, directly within notes, improving productivity.

Possible disadvantages

  • Learning Curve
    New users may find Logseq's extensive features and unique workflow approach challenging to learn without dedicated time and effort.
  • Sync Complexity
    While storing notes locally is a pro for privacy, it requires additional tools or manual methods to sync notes across multiple devices.
  • Mobile App Limitations
    The mobile version of Logseq is still in development, meaning it may lack some features and fluidity found in the desktop version.
  • Resource Intensive
    Logseq can consume considerable system resources, particularly when dealing with large datasets or extensive use of graph view.
  • Community Dependency
    As an open-source project, certain features may rely on community contributions, which could lead to inconsistent updates or support.
  • Customization Complexity
    While high customization is a benefit, it can become overwhelming and complex to manage for users who prefer a more straightforward tool.
